What is a Mushroom Beanie?

A mushroom beanie, also known as a mycelium beanie, is a unique headwear item made from the roots of mushrooms. The mycelium, the vegetative part of a fungus, is cultivated and shaped into a durable material that can be used for various products, including beanies.

How It’s Made

The process starts with mixing mushroom mycelium with agricultural waste, such as corn husks or sawdust. This mixture is then placed into molds shaped like beanies, where the mycelium grows and binds the waste together. After a period of growth, the mycelium solidifies, creating a sturdy and biodegradable material – perfect for sustainable fashion!

Environmental Benefits

One of the most appealing aspects of the mushroom beanie is its positive impact on the environment. Traditional textiles like cotton and wool require vast amounts of water and land for cultivation, whereas mycelium-based materials can be grown in a controlled environment using minimal resources. Additionally, at the end of its lifecycle, the beanie can be composted, returning nutrients to the soil.
